                                                11.11.09: [Euroleague] Fenerbache Ulker vs. Montepaschi Siena OVER 144.5 (-115)
                                                One thing Montepaschi can do is score the basketball. In 3 Euroleague clashes, the Italian club has averaged 83 ppg with totals of 85, 84 & 82. Making it more impressive is that two of those games were on the road. Their defense has been steady after their squash job on Cibona when they were held to 40, allowing 64 & 65 points in their other two games. Fenerbache continues with injury concerns, but have maintained as a steady, but not spectacular offense. The Turkish outfit scored 59 in a blowout loss on the road to Regal Barcleona, tallied 78 in OT (64 in regulation) over ASVEL & hit 67 last time out in a five point win over Cibona. In domestic competition, they are averaging in the low 70s. Montepaschi should once again be good for 80 points. That leaves Fenerbache to net 65 or so to get this done. Not expecting the Italians to let up here as they continue to battle Regal Barcelona for the top spot at 3-0 in this group and Fenerbache is just one game back.

                                                                  11.12.09: [Euroleague] Efes Pilsen +11.5 (-115)
                                                                  Olympiakos hosting Euroleague matches is certainly different than the Greeks on the road, however without Josh Childress (Swine Flu) I am going to question this one a touch. Also read a report that Von Wafer, who probably would have gotten some of Childress' minutes, is state-side after a death in the family. The Greeks have won both home contests in the EL comfortably by 20+, but those came against Orleanaise & Lietuvous Rytas. Efes Pilsen - when they want - can be formidable. They proved that point by storming back from a big deficit against group leaders Unicaja last time to force OT, eventually losing by 5 on the road. They also lost to Rytas on the road, so which club travels to Greece today? I believe one that is desperate for a win. Losing today drops them to 1-3 and sinks them to possibly as low as 4th in their group and in big trouble as far as advancing to the Round of 16. Efes is playing solid ball in their domestic league also with a win over fellow EL member Fenerbache last time out by 13. I'm hoping they bring that form today & believe if they do, this game stays within single digits.
